In the shadow of Amiens' fight to stay in Ligue 1, the TFC also battled behind the scenes in the spring.

The last of the French elite had filed on May 25 an appeal before the Council of State to try to win his maintenance on the green carpet.

The administrative court communicated on Monday "the withdrawal of action of the request" from the Toulouse club.

Clearly, the TFC chaired since July by Damien Comolli, representative of the American fund RedBird Capital Partners, dropped the case.

His former boss Olivier Sadran had sought to overturn the decision taken on April 30 by the board of directors of the Professional Football League (LFP).

Ranking frozen and contested

Following the interruption of the championships because of the coronavirus epidemic, the LFP had frozen the classification, and sent Toulouse as Amiens in Ligue 2.

After six days of L2, the Haut-Garonnais club, which aims for an immediate recovery, occupies 15th place and the Picardy club 17th.
